DESCRIPTION:
This mod is a simple port of Chryssalid Abomination enemy from A Better Advent 2 to WOTC. Why? Because gigantic NOPEbug, that's why. (Aside from size and strength it's a pretty vanilla enemy so if you're looking for something fancy that's probably not your mod... may I suggest CX's Hive mod instead, maybe?)

NOTES:
- Can't test encounter lists right now since I don't have a campaign far enough in Force Level for it to spawn. Unless I did a typo somewhere though it should spawn without issues.
- Comes with pre-built compability for ABA and Hive followers and encounter lists. The latter was a bit eyeballed since I don't use Hive myself.

CREDITS AND THANKS:
- DerBK for the original Abomination
- Pavonis team for Long War 2, from which comes the model used for this enemy
